Paragraph 1: Setting the Stage for Local Governance Elections

The political landscape of Lagos State, Nigeria, is gearing up for a significant electoral event – the Local Government Elections scheduled for July 12th.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u, recognizing the pivotal role of grassroots governance, has initiated a strategic move to consolidate the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) party’s position and ensure a resounding victory. A stakeholders’ parley, bringing together party leaders, elected officials, appointed representatives, and all candidates vying for positions under the APC banner, is set to take place at the State House, Marina. This gathering aims to serve as a crucial platform for mobilizing the party’s machinery and fine-tuning strategies for the upcoming elections.

Paragraph 5: Formalizing the Journey to Victory: Flag Presentation Ceremony

Prior to the stakeholders’ parley, the APC held a significant event to officially present flags to its candidates contesting the local government elections. This flag-off ceremony, held at the APC State Secretariat in Ogba, marked the formal commencement of the party’s campaign. A total of 57 chairmanship candidates and 376 councillorship candidates received their flags, symbolizing their official endorsement by the party and their readiness to embark on the electoral journey. This event served as a morale booster for the candidates and signaled the party’s preparedness to engage in a robust and well-organized campaign.
